Sinopsis

A sequel to "Dickens", this is a resume of all the scholarly research and imaginative reinterpretation which were the hallmarks of the previous book. It is a long essay on the life and work of Dickens in which Ackroyd demonstrates his argument for connecting the life and work, and, in the process, throws light upon both. In addition he has written 20 introductions to the whole range of Dickens' published work, from novels to journalism, in which he analyzes the writings themselves while at the same time providing an account of the novelist's career. The author also wrote "The Last Testament of Oscar Wilde", "Hawksmoor", "Chatterton" and "First Light" and his biography of T.S. Eliot was awarded the Whitbread PRize for the best biography of 1984.
